Porosity significantly affects heat conduction in materials, as increased porosity typically leads to lower thermal conductivity. This occurs because the air or gas-filled voids in a porous material act as thermal insulators, reducing the overall ability of the material to conduct heat. Consequently, highly porous materials are often utilized for insulation purposes, where low thermal conductivity is desirable. However, the specific impact of porosity on heat conduction also depends on factors like the material's composition and the size and distribution of the pores.
